Notes. The table lists the name (Name-Lens) and Gaia DR2 source ID (DR2_ID) of the lens and DR2 source IDs of the background sources. The background sources are grouped into sources where Gaia DR2 only provides the position (2-parameter), sources with a full five-parameter solution (5-parameter), and sources with a five-parameter solution in combination with an expected precision in the along-scan direction better than 0.5 mas (sigma). The assumed mass of the lens is listed in Min, and the expected precisions of the mass determination for the three cases are given in σMx, including the uncertainty due to the errors in the input parameters, as well as the percentage in σMx/Min, where x indicates the use of all background stars (all), background stars with a five-parameters solution (5-par.), and background stars with expected precision in the along-scan direction better than 0.5 mas (sig.).
